This Lindy right-angled power cable is designed for users with modern flat-screen TVs, enabling them to place their devices closer to the wall. Its primary benefit is space-saving, allowing for a tidier setup by routing the cable neatly behind the TV. A minor caveat is its short 0.5m length, which may limit placement options in some scenarios. The cable features a UK 3 Pin Plug (Type G) to an IEC C7 coupler, is fully moulded, supports up to 3A, and is RoHS, REACH, and CE certified.

FAQs

What is the main advantage of the right-angled connector?

The right-angled connector allows the cable to bend at a 90-degree angle, enabling devices like flat-screen TVs to be placed closer to the wall and creating a cleaner, less obtrusive setup.

What is the maximum current this cable can handle?

This cable is rated for a maximum current of 3 Amps. It is suitable for most common consumer electronics but not for high-power appliances.

How do I know if my device uses an IEC C7 connector?

An IEC C7 connector is often described as a 'figure-of-eight' shape. Check the power input port on your device; if it matches this shape, it likely requires a C7 cable. This is different from a C13 (kettle lead) or other power connector types.

Is this cable suitable for outdoor use?

No, this cable is designed for indoor use only. It is not weatherproofed.

What is the warranty period for this cable?

Lindy typically offers a 10-year warranty on this product, but please refer to Lindy's official warranty statement for specific details.

Can I use this cable with a C8 (female) port?

No, this cable has a C7 (female) connector and is designed to plug into a C8 (male) power inlet on a device. It is not compatible with C8 female ports.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up: This is a plug-and-play device. Simply connect the UK 3 Pin Plug to a compatible wall socket or power strip, and connect the right-angled IEC C7 coupler to the power input on your device. Ensure both connections are secure.

Compatibility:

  • Plug: Compatible with all standard UK 3 Pin (Type G) sockets.
  • Connector: Designed for devices with an IEC C7 (figure-of-eight) power inlet. Please verify your device requires a C7 connector before purchase, as it differs from C5, C13, or C15 connectors.
  • Current: Suitable for devices drawing up to 3 Amps.

Care:

  • Avoid kinking or tightly bending the cable.
  • Keep the connectors clean and free from dust and debris.
  • Store in a cool, dry place when not in use.
  • Do not expose to liquids or extreme temperatures outside the operating range of -10°C to 70°C.
